Cheping, Cheiping, vbl. n. [f. Chepe v.1] Chirping.1513 Doug. vii. Prol. 70.
Smale byrdis … In chyrmyng and with cheping changit thar sang a1585 Polwart Flyt. 807 (T).
Thy cheiping and peiping with weiping thow sall rew
